Description

9 and 11 Dalrymple Street in Girvan is a late 19th-century building featuring two storeys and an attic, with a two-bay design. The exterior is made of polished red sandstone. The ground floor has been altered to accommodate modern shops. On the first floor, there are two shallow curved recessed bays, each with three lights, separated by piers. Above this, there is a cornice and a parapet, and the building is topped with a slate roof.
